Another limitation:

the *.inf file(s) won't match if they are encoding in weird format like 
UTF-16 little endian, like bcmwl5.inf file provided by Dell 1[345][795]0 
(mini)PCI wireless cards  ( chipset broadcom PCI_DEV=4320).
workaround: On this case, open file with MS-notepad then save it with 
"unicode" as file format (aka UTF-8): search-win-drivers.pl will "match 
it" .
